עבור לתוכן

עזרה עם מוד שמחובר ליציאת LPT של המחשב

Featured Replies

פורסם

שלום,

בניתי מעגל כלשהו שמשתמש ברגלי השידור של יציאת ה LPT

יש לי מערכת הפעלה WINXP SP2

דרך היציאה אני שולט על המעגל - הפעלה וכיבוי שלו בעזרת הרגליים 2 ו 18 (רגל השידור הראשונה של היציאה והאדמה שלה)

בכל הפעלה מחדש של המחשב, איך שהמערכת הפעלה עולה היא מאתחלת את יציאת ה LPT

וזה גורם לזוג רגליים 2 ו 18 להוציא +5V

מה שגורם להפעלת המעגל שלי בלי שאני רוצה

יש אפשרות להגדיר במערכת הפעלה שהיציאה תאותחל למצב שכל הרגליים של המידע יהיו ב "0" במקום ב "1" כמו שקורה אצלי עכשיו?

הפעולה של ה "1" מגיעה רק עם הפעלת המערכת הפעלה..

אז זה אומר שההגדרות בביוס לא משנות למה שאני צריך

מישהו מכיר איפה במערכת הפעלה אני יכול לקבוע את מצב הרגליים של המידע ל "0" בהפעלה?

תודה :xyxthumbs:

פורסם

לאיזה מקור מתח המעגל החיצוני מחובר?

סוללה, ספק חיצוני, מתח מהמחשב?

לא נראה לי שאפשר לשנות את אתחול הפורט אבל אולי יש דרך לגרום למעגל שלך להתעלם מהמצב הזמני.

פורסם
  • מחבר

המעגל לא מחובר למתח חיצוני בדיוק..

הרגליים 2 ו 18 פשוט מחוברות לממסר

אם הממסר מקבל +5V ב2 רגליים שלו

הוא מקצר 2 אחרות

זה ממסר מכאני כזה

במחשב נייד עם WIN2K זה לא היה לי אותו דבר..

באתחול של היציאה הסיביות נשארו על 0 ולא סגר לי את המעגל..

פורסם

מצד אחד אתה יכול לחפש איך להפסיק את זה מצד שני אתה יכול להתאים את המעגל למחשב ולגרום לו לא להגיב בבדיקת המערכת הזאת...

פורסם

אני מניח שאם חופרים ב Registry של XP אולי תמצא משהו.

כדאי לך אולי לפתוח דיון בפורום Windows ולשאול איך מנטרלים אתחול של הפורט (או מה שזה לא יהיה) .

אבל ניתן כנראה לפתור את זה גם באלקטרוניקה.

האם הפינים מחוברים ישירות לממסר?

ממסר בד"כ צריך קצת זרם שפורט לא יכול לספק.

האם ישנו איזה טרנזיסטור או רכיב אחר שמחובר לפני הממסר. הכי טוב זה סכימה אם אפשר.

והאם בכלל אתה רוצה/יכול להכניס שינוי במעגל או שזה נתון ואתה חייב לפתור את זה בתוכנה?

פורסם
  • מחבר

היציאה מחוברת ישירות לממסר

והמתח שהיציאה מספקת כן מספיק להפעלת הממסר..

אני מעדיף לבטל את זה במערכת הפעלה מאשר לבצע שינויים במעגל..

פורסם

באתחול המערכת בד"כ אין לצפות את מצב היציאות של הפורטים. זה פעולה שיכולה גם להשתנות ממחשב למחשב.

לכן הכי נכון זה לבנות מעגל שניתן לשלוט על ההפעלה שלו ולהפעילו רק לאחר שהמחשב סיים את האתחול ותוכנת השליטה על הפורט עובדת.

אם המחשב היה מספק מתח למעגל ניתן היה לבנות טיימר שמשהה את הפעולה עד להתיצבות המחשב.

היות ואתה לא רוצה לשנות את המעגל אולי תנסה את השינוי ב Registry (אני לא בטוח איך זה משפיע בדיוק אבל אולי שווה לנסות).

A: Some versions of Windows XP look for devices by periodically writing to the port. A registry key can disable this behavior.

The following registry setting disables the port writes:

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Parport\Parameters]

"DisableWarmPoll"=dword:00000001

The following registry setting enables the port writes:

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Parport\Parameters]

"DisableWarmPoll"=dword:00000000

You can make these changes in Windows' regedit utility. Or to make the changes automatically, create and save the following text files:

DisableWarmBoot.reg contains the following text: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Parport\Parameters]

"DisableWarmPoll"=dword:00000001

EnableWarmBoot.reg contains the following text: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Parport\Parameters]

"DisableWarmPoll"=dword:00000000

To change a registry key, run the program.

As always, use caution when working with the registry, which contains critical values for configuring and running the PC.

After making a change, reboot the PC.

Disabling the port writes can also eliminate port timeout errors received in some applications.

מקור: http://www.lvr.com/jansfaq.htm

פורסם
  • מחבר

אוקיי אני אנסה את זה

תודה רבה לך :xyxthumbs:

פורסם

אגב אתה יכול פשוט לבנות מעגל שגם עם הוא מקבל את ה - 5V אז הוא לא יעבוד או להוסיף מפסק

  • 2 שבועות מאוחר יותר...
פורסם
  • מחבר

ניסיתי את השינוי ברג'יסטרי וזה לא עובד טוב..

יש לי גרסא WIN XP SP2

יש עוד הצעות?

(אני לא רוצה לעשות שינויים במעגל.. ואי אפשר לחבר אותו רק אחרי שהמחשב עולה.. זה אמור להיות אוטומטי והמחשב עושה ריסט כל כמה שעות לבד..)

פורסם

תנסה לעשות את היציאת lpt על disable ולעשות ריסט.. אם זה עובד, תפתח את הרעיון איך להשתמש בזה...

ארכיון

דיון זה הועבר לארכיון ולא ניתן להוסיף בו תגובות חדשות.

דיונים חדשים